Pacific Palisades resident Nancy E. Greene, much-beloved wife of Richard A. Greene, passed away May 16 at Cedars-Sinai Hospital. Struggling with serious illness for many years, Nancy essentially died of complications of lupus. She was only 69. Nancy’s loved ones wish her peace on the next leg of her journey. They will remember her in better times: justifiably proud of accomplishments as an NICU (Neonatal Intensive Care Unit) nurse and receiving a master’s degree in public health and pursuing doctoral studies in epidemiology; brown as a nut in summer; happily schussing down the slopes in winter; decking the halls to the max for Christmas; and enjoying life with her husband ‘ a Palisades Optimist Club member who misses her very much. Donations in Nancy’s memory may be made to the Lupus Foundation (www.Lupus.org).
